What Are Antitrust Laws?

Federal antitrust and trade regulations are intended to support competitive business practices and restrict collusion, price fixing, monopolies, and predatory pricing. The Federal Trade Commission and Department of Justice enforce federal antitrust laws. Primary antitrust laws include:

  • The Sherman Act
  • The Clayton Act
  • The Federal Trade Commission Act
  • The Robinson-Patman Act

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Antitrust Lawyer?

Federal prosecutors and private parties can file antitrust lawsuits. As a business owner, you may need an antitrust attorney if you want to file an antitrust case or are responding to an antitrust lawsuit. If you are a small business owner and a competitor is engaging in anticompetitive business practices, an attorney can help you level the playing field. Examples of antitrust violations include:

  • Price fixing
  • Wage fixing
  • Rigging bids
  • Colluding to limit competition
  • Forming a cartel

How Can an Antitrust Lawyer Help Me?

An antitrust lawyer can help you stop anti-competitive practices that are hurting your small business. A competitor or group of competitors can get together to collude on price fixing or divide markets. Your lawyer can file a lawsuit against these antitrust practices to stop attempted monopolization. An antitrust lawyer can:

  • Report anticompetitive practices to the FTC
  • File a private claim for violations of the Sherman or Clayton Act
  • Help recover triple damages for antitrust violations
  • Negotiate a settlement agreement
  • Represent you in mediation or arbitration settings
  • Gather the evidence and work with the experts to build a strong case
